To get access control ID cards with barcodes in India, you should work with a factory-direct PVC ID card manufacturer that offers custom card design, high-resolution barcode printing, professional heat lamination, and pan-India delivery.
Barcode-based access control ID cards are commonly used in offices, factories, schools, colleges, hospitals, warehouses, and institutions for entry control, attendance tracking, visitor management, and internal security. Since barcodes must remain clear and scannable for long-term daily use, manufacturing quality is essential.
Introduction
Many organizations face problems like:
Barcodes not scanning properly
Smudged or faded barcode lines
Peeling lamination affecting scan accuracy
Inconsistent card quality in bulk orders
These issues usually happen when cards are printed using low-resolution printing or cold lamination. Access control cards require precision printing and proper sealing.

2. Finalize Barcode Type & Usage
Confirm with your access system provider:
1D barcodes (Code 39, Code 128) – most common
2D barcodes (QR codes) – higher data capacity
The manufacturer will size and place the barcode for maximum scan reliability.

5. Printing + Heat Lamination
Professional access cards are made using:
High-resolution digital/offset printing
Multi-layer PVC construction
Heat-and-pressure lamination (adhesive-free)
This protects the barcode from scratches and fading.
6. Barcode Testing & Quality Inspection
Before dispatch:
Barcode readability is tested
Print contrast and edge clarity are verified
Slot punching (if needed) is antenna/scan-safe
Only tested cards are packed and shipped.
Recommended Material & Durability Standards
Always insist on:
Virgin CR80-grade PVC
Matte or glossy overlay as per scanner compatibility
Heat lamination (not cold lamination)
Reinforced slot punching
These standards ensure long-term scan reliability.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Printing barcodes too small or near edges
Using glossy finish without scanner testing
Accepting cold-laminated cards
Skipping barcode testing before dispatch
Ordering from resellers without factories
These mistakes lead to access failures and reorders.
